As he tries to figure out what to do about this perilous situation, he unsuccessfully taxidermies a fish, discovers an underground golf-club-trafficking operation, and writes a seminal work of Central American avant-garde poetry called “The Song of the Virgin Child.” It is the first poem he has ever written and the last he will write. February 28th, 2012 César Aira’s Varamo reaffirms Aira’s place as seminal Latin American writer whose work wanders between bizarre situations and philosophical digressions.Ī government employee in the newly independent state of Panama is handed counterfeit bills when picking up his monthly salary of two hundred pesos.
